The Cultural Significance of Ube

Ube, known scientifically as Dioscorea alata, has a long-standing history in various cuisines. Predominantly used in Filipino desserts, ube is celebrated for its natural purple color and subtly sweet flavor. It’s a staple ingredient in beloved dishes such as ube halaya, ice cream, and pastries. Beyond the Philippines, ube has gained popularity in many parts of Southeast Asia and around the world, admired for its vibrant color and versatile culinary uses.

In recent years, ube has become a global sensation, inspiring chefs and home bakers alike to experiment. Its striking purple hue makes it an eye-catching addition to baked goods, offering a visual treat alongside its rich taste. The Culinary Significance of Snickerdoodles

The snickerdoodle is a classic American cookie known for its soft texture and cinnamon sugar coating. Traditionally, it’s celebrated for its simplicity and comforting flavor. Over time, bakers have adapted the snickerdoodle, adding ingredients like chocolate, nuts, or, as with this variation, ube, to enhance its appeal and complexity.

This cookie’s enduring popularity lies in its ability to evoke warm memories and create a sense of familiarity. The cinnamon sugar crust offers a fragrant, sweet crunch that complements the tender interior.
